  3. Thanks. Well, moto trials is legal everywhere. If you have a road registered trials motorbike (the newer ones are all road registered) then you can legally ride your motorbike On The Roads without problems. The problem is when you are trying to jump on some obstacles, or benches or anything. That's what the police doesn't likes to see. And if your motorbike is not road registered then it's illegal to use it anywhere in the city.
